Gas Heater Installation in Kansas City, MO
Gas heater installation services involve setting up and connecting gas-powered heating units to provide reliable warmth during colder months. These projects typically include installing new gas heaters in homes, replacing outdated or inefficient units, and ensuring proper connection to existing gas lines and ventilation systems. Homeowners often seek this service to improve heating efficiency, upgrade to modern units, or add heating capacity to specific areas such as basements, garages, or living rooms.
Before requesting gas heater install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including any necessary modifications to existing gas lines or ventilation systems. It’s also common to inquire about the types of gas heaters available, such as furnaces or wall-mounted units, and which options best suit the property's size and layout. Clarifying these details helps ensure the installation meets heating needs safely and effectively.

Gas Heater Installation Questions
What types of gas heaters can be installed? Common options include wall-mounted units, floor-standing models, and combo systems designed for different space sizes and heating needs.
Is professional installation necessary for a gas heater? Yes, proper installation ensures safety, optimal performance, and compliance with local codes and regulations.
What should property owners consider before installing a gas heater? Consider the size of the space, ventilation requirements, and existing gas lines to ensure compatibility and safety.
Can gas heater installation be combined with existing heating systems? Yes, it can often complement or replace existing heating solutions for improved efficiency and comfort.
